Donald closes in on Scottish Open lead, Mickelson finds form

World number one Luke Donald put himself back into winning contention after shooting a flawless second round 68 on Friday to be just three shots back in the defence of his Scottish Open title.

Donald birdied his second and third holes and then, after 13 straight pars, birdied his closing two holes to move to nine-under par, trailing Italy's Francesco Molinari (70) and Sweden's Alex Noren (66) who head the event on 12-under.
